Pistons

The pistons nominal dia 86.5 mm are provided with a combustion chamber approx. 17 mm deep compression ratio e 7.5 1 . The installation position is identified by an arrow punched into piston crown pointing toward V-belt pulley . The piston pin bore is offset from center by 1.5 mm. The cylinder bores and piston dias are subdivided into 3 tolerance groups. Porsche 924s Engine Specifications

11 Oil pressure sending unit The oil filter is located on a flange mounted to the engine which also houses the thermostat for the oil cooler. The thermostat opens at a temperature of 87 C. The pressurized oil for lubricating the turbo-charger branches off at the oil filter flange and flows through a separate line to the bearings of the turbocharger. The return oil flows directly back to the oil pan by gravity. The oil cooler is mounted directly behind the air ducts in the front spoiler....

Turbocharger System

Vacuum 924 Turbo

Idle The engine draws-in fresh air through air filter 1 . The air flows across the sensor plate of mixture control unit 2 into intake duct 3 and to compressor 4 of the turbocharger. From here, the intake air is fed to the engine by way of a pressure duct 6 through the throttle valve housing 7 . The exhaust gases are routed through exhaust manifold 10 to turbine 11 of the turbocharger and from there through the catalytic converter and muffler. Turbocharger

The exhaust gas turbocharger is mounted at the right side of the engine under the exhaust manifold. In contrast to the 930, the pop-off valve 8 on the 924 is located directly in the compressor housing between the inlet and outlet. 1 Compressor housing inlet side 7 Compressor housing outlet side The safety switch is located in the pressure duct between the turbocharger and throttle valve housing. Cylinder Head Tightening Specifications

Circuit Lubrification Turbo Porsche 996

When new 1. Lubricate threads of cylinder head bolts, tighten in steps to 40, 80, 110 Nm. 29.5,59,81 ft . lbs. 2. Retighten bolts after 1 hour engine stopped . Loosen the bolts 1 4 turn and retighten to 110 Nm 81 ft . lbs. . 3. Retighten bolts after test drive, with engine cooled down, as described under 2. Ignition System

Porsche 924 Ignition System

The 924 turbo engine has a breakeriess transistorized ignition system. There are two resistor wires leading to the coil. The wire between terminal 15 on the ignition control unit and terminal 15 on ignition coil has a resistance of 1.0 2. The wire between terminal 16 on the starter and terminal 15 on ignition coil has a resistance of 1.5 i2. Note Do not make these wires shorter during repairs.

With the engine stopped, or running with less than 0.1 bar boost, both springs operate against the control valve. The control pressure is high. Control pressure will drop full load enrichment when boost pressure at the top of the diaphragm exceeds 0.1 bar. The operation test for full load enrichment can be made only when the boost pressure is above 0.3 bar.
